Mode-Conditioning Patch Cord for an SFP Module
The mode-conditioning patch cord assembly is composed of duplex optical fibers, including a 
single-mode-to-multimode offset launch fiber connected to the transmitter, and a second conventional 
graded-index multimode optical fiber connected to the receiver. The use of a plug-to-plug patch cord 
maximizes the power budget of multimode 1000BASE LX and 1000BASE LH links.
The mode-conditioning patch cord is required to comply with IEEE standards. The IEEE found that link 
distances could not be met with certain types of fiber-optic cable cores. The solution is to launch light 
from the laser at a precise offset from the center, which is accomplished by using the mode-conditioning 
patch cord. At the output of the patch cord, the
 
SFP-GE-L=
 
is compliant with the IEEE 802.3z standard 
for 1000BASE LX.
Console and Auxiliary Port Connection Equipment
The NPE-G2 has a DCE-mode console port for connecting a console terminal, and a DTE-mode 
auxiliary port for connecting a modem or other DCE device (such as a CSU/DSU or other router) to your 
router. However, with an I/O controller also installed in the router, the default console and auxiliary ports 
are on the I/O controller, and you cannot access the console and auxiliary ports on the NPE-G2. 
Note
Both the console and the auxiliary ports are asynchronous serial ports; any devices connected to these 
ports must be capable of asynchronous transmission. (Asynchronous is the most common type of serial 
device; for example, most modems are asynchronous devices.)
The NPE-G2 uses RJ-45 media for console port and auxiliary port connections. 
Before connecting a terminal to the console port, configure the terminal to match the router console port 
as follows: 9600 baud, 8 data bits, no parity, 2 stop bits (9600 8N2). After you establish normal router 
operation, you can disconnect the terminal.
